INPUT Menu INPUT Menu (continued) Item COMPONENT Description Using the ▲/▼ buttons switches the function of the COMPONENT (Y, Cb/Pb, Cr/Pr) port. COMPONENT ó SCART RGB When the SCART RGB is selected, the COMPONENT (Y, Cb/Pb, Cr/Pr) and VIDEO ports will function as a SCART RGB port. ALAN SCART adapter or SCART cable is required for a SCART RGB input to the projector. For details, contact your dealer. (1) Use the ◄/► buttons to select the input port. (2) Using the ▲/▼ buttons switches the mode for video format. If the picture becomes unstable (e.g. an irregular picture, lack of color), please select the mode according to the input signal. Using the ▲/▼ cursor buttons changes the M1-D signal mode. NORMAL ó ENHANCED M1-D NORMAL ENHANCED Feature Suitable for DVD signals (16-235) Suitable for VGA signals (0-255) • If the contrast of the screen image is too strong or too weak, try finding a more suitable mode.
